Kira Tippenhauer was born and raised in Port-au-Prince, Haiti which is where she was introduced to pottery at a young age by a very close family member, Haitian renown ceramic artist, Marithou Dupoux.
In 2004, Kira moved to the United States to pursue her education. While in graduate school she realized that she never grew tired of ceramic practice. Whether it being wheel throwing, sculpting, or hand building, ceramic art has always been Kira’s therapy.
For the past decade, Kira has had a persistent affinity for hand building work,although it requires time and patience. Kira currently resides in Fort-Lauderdale, Florida. You can find Kira at The Little Haiti Cultural Center hostings workshops or at The Miami Flea selling her handmade ceramic.
